The way Casino Leaderboards Truly Are

A casino leaderboard is a instant ranking table that grants points to players based on specific in-game actions, normally within a set tournament window. Instead of just chasing a jackpot in a single slot, you’re competing against other players for a slice of a prize pool. The ranking criteria can differ: some leaderboards count total wagered, others monitor the number of spins, and plenty utilize a win multiplier formula that divides your biggest single win by your bet size. I’ve seen Spinboss Casino run leaderboards where the scoring system is detailed clearly in the tournament rules, so you know exactly which metric drives your position. Rankings refresh automatically, usually with a short delay of a few seconds, which adds a competitive edge that static bonus offers cannot match. From a player’s perspective, leaderboards turn solitary sessions into a shared event. You’re not merely playing against the house; you’re gauging your performance against dozens or hundreds of other participants. This structure recognizes consistency and smart game selection, because not all titles contribute equally to the points tally. Reward Pools and Bonus Structures

The prize system on Spinboss Casino leaderboards distributes rewards across multiple tiers, not just the top spot. I’ve noticed prize pools vary from a few hundred euros in daily events to several thousand in monthly marathons, though the exact figures are based on the promotion. The prizes themselves belong to distinct categories, and understanding the difference matters for your withdrawal strategy.

  • Cash prizes: These go straight in your real-money balance and usually carry no wagering requirements. You can withdraw them right away, subject to standard payment processing times.
  • Bonus funds: The most frequent reward type. These include a wagering requirement, often between 25x and 40x the bonus amount, which you must fulfill before converting them to cash.
  • Free spins: Granted for specific slot titles. Winnings from free spins are commonly converted to bonus funds with their own wagering conditions.
  • Physical goods or entries to exclusive events: Less frequent but from time to time offered in high-tier tournaments. Terms for these are consistently detailed separately.

I consistently check the prize breakdown before joining because a big headline figure might consist mostly of bonus funds with steep playthrough requirements. The terms page at Spinboss Casino displays the wagering multiplier and the time window you have to meet it, typically between 7 and 30 days. If you prefer immediate liquidity, choose leaderboards that highlight cash prizes or free spins with low or no wagering on the winnings.

Types of Leaderboard Events You Can Discover

Slot Tournament Leaderboards

Slot competitions are the core of the leaderboard range at Spinboss Casino, and I’ve noticed they cover a broad range of themes and volatility levels. Points usually revolves around the win-to-bet ratio, meaning a small bet that lands a massive multiplier can boost you up the ranks. Some tournaments, though, use a points-per-spin model where every real-money round earns a fixed number of points, favoring high-volume play. The eligible game list is always announced upfront, and it often features classic three-reel slots alongside modern Megaways titles. I’d advise verifying whether the tournament utilizes a dedicated balance or draws from your main casino wallet; Spinboss Casino generally utilizes your real cash balance, so every spin matters toward both the game’s standard payouts and your leaderboard score. Slot tournament length changes, but I’ve seen 24-hour sprints alongside week-long marathons. Prize distribution typically gives the top 10 to 50 players, with the winner claiming the largest share of a cash or bonus pool. This indicates you don’t need to finish first to gain value, and consistent top-20 finishes can add up to meaningful returns over time.

Daily Drops & Wins

A system that pops up regularly on the Spinboss Casino platform is the Daily Drops & Wins mechanic, which mixes random prize drops with a parallel leaderboard. Any qualifying spin can trigger an instant cash prize, independent of the game’s normal paytable, while your biggest win multiplier simultaneously adds to a tournament ranking. I find this dual-layer system particularly captivating because it rewards both luck and sustained play. The random drops are usually modest (a few times your bet) but they occur frequently enough to keep the session engaging. Meanwhile, the leaderboard component tracks your highest single-spin multiplier over the tournament period, so a single extraordinary spin can guarantee a top position. The terms usually state that only spins above a minimum bet apply, and the full list of participating games resides in the promotion details. From a practical standpoint, this format diminishes the advantage of sheer volume, making it more attainable to casual players who might only have time for a few hundred spins a day.
